#1c9502 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1c9502 is composed of 11% red, 58.4%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 81.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 98.7% yellow and 41.6% black. It has a hue angle of 109.4 degrees, a saturation of 97.4% and a lightness of 29.6%. #1c9502 color hex could be obtained by blending #38ff04 with #002b00. Closest websafe color is: #339900.

Shades and Tints of #1c9502

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030e00 is the darkest color, while #fafff9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1c9502

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#494f48 is the less saturated color, while #1c9502 is the most saturated one.
